A standard residential garage door can weigh anywhere from 150 to 300 pounds. That weight is controlled by a system of springs, cables, rollers, and tracks working under high tension.
When one part starts failing, the entire system becomes unpredictable.

Understanding why failure happens helps prevent it.
Springs carry the entire weight of the door. When they weaken or snap, the system becomes unbalanced instantly.
Frayed or loose cables can cause the door to tilt or drop suddenly.
If the door is not properly guided, it can derail from the system.
Old rollers create resistance, leading to strain and unpredictable movement.
Faulty sensors can cause the door to close improperly or fail to stop when needed.

A common situation: A homeowner hears a slight “pop” sound when opening the door. The door still works, so they ignore it. Over time, that sound becomes louder, and eventually the door starts tilting to one side.
What actually happened? A spring or cable was already failing, but the system was still partially functioning.
This is exactly how unsafe conditions develop—slowly and quietly.
An unsafe garage door is not just inconvenient—it can be dangerous.
Springs in particular store extreme tension, which is why they should never be ignored when showing wear.
